X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=packages%2Fvtk%2Fsrc%2FbbvtkUnMosaic.cxx;h=b449f144623ebf411a0d06d133fd4e625e494116;hb=b7dd1ccf2db9c018dabadd835739aba15f3664ba;hp=a28daaf9fc69d1aca38352b608b1782ac28e9aed;hpb=6aec6be5feb2750065fdf2f86b8cafce58f0a417;p=bbtk.git diff --git a/packages/vtk/src/bbvtkUnMosaic.cxx b/packages/vtk/src/bbvtkUnMosaic.cxx index a28daaf..b449f14 100644 --- a/packages/vtk/src/bbvtkUnMosaic.cxx +++ b/packages/vtk/src/bbvtkUnMosaic.cxx @@ -2,8 +2,8 @@ Program: bbtk Module: $RCSfile: bbvtkUnMosaic.cxx,v $ Language: C++ - Date: $Date: 2010/10/05 14:33:49 $ - Version: $Revision: 1.1 $ + Date: $Date: 2011/05/31 09:39:11 $ + Version: $Revision: 1.3 $ =========================================================================*/ /* --------------------------------------------------------------------- @@ -85,7 +85,6 @@ namespace bbvtk /// void UnMosaic::Process() { - int nbImagesPerRow = (unsigned int)bbGetInputNbImagesPerRow(); int nbImagesInMosaic = (unsigned int)bbGetInputNbImagesInMosaic(); @@ -103,7 +102,7 @@ namespace bbvtk } -vtkImageData * unMosaic(vtkImageData *imageIn, int nbImagesPerRow, int numberOfImagesInMosaic) +vtkImageData * UnMosaic::unMosaic(vtkImageData *imageIn, int nbImagesPerRow, int numberOfImagesInMosaic) { int inputdims[3]; int outputdims[3]; @@ -130,18 +129,18 @@ vtkImageData * unMosaic(vtkImageData *imageIn, int nbImagesPerRow, int numberOfI unsigned short *output =(unsigned short *)(vtkImageOut->GetScalarPointer()); unsigned short *dest = output; - int lgrLigne = outputdims[0]; - int lgrImage = lgrLigne*outputdims[1]; //*sizeof(unsigned short); + int dimXImageElem = outputdims[0]; + int dimYImageElem = outputdims[1]; + int lgrImage = dimXImageElem*dimYImageElem; int debImage; for (int i=0; i